首页 > 科技 >

Linux下搭建ftp服务 🌐💡

发布时间:2025-03-13 14:54:35来源:

在数字化时代,FTP(文件传输协议)依然是数据共享的重要工具之一。对于Linux用户来说,搭建一个属于自己的FTP服务器并不复杂。首先,你需要确保系统已安装vsftpd(Very Secure FTP Daemon)。如果未安装,可以通过命令 `sudo apt-get install vsftpd` 来完成安装。接着,配置文件 `/etc/vsftpd.conf` 是核心所在,你可以在这里设置匿名访问、本地用户权限等选项。例如,启用本地用户登录时,记得将 `local_enable=YES` 写入配置文件中。完成编辑后,使用 `sudo systemctl restart vsftpd` 重启服务以应用更改。为了安全起见,建议开启防火墙规则允许FTP流量通过,比如 `sudo ufw allow 20/udp` 和 `sudo ufw allow 21/tcp`。最后,测试你的FTP服务器是否正常工作,可以尝试用FileZilla或命令行工具连接到服务器地址。只要一切顺利,恭喜你!现在你已经成功搭建了一个功能完善的FTP服务器,可以随时上传和下载文件了!💪🎉

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。